Starting Your civil engineering Career in North Tonawanda

New graduates entering the civil engineering profession in North Tonawanda will find that various sectors actively seek early-career talent. Large consulting firms such as AECOM, Jacobs, and WSP are prominent employers, offering robust training pipelines for recent graduates through their Engineering Internships and structured programs focused on achieving the Professional Engineer (PE) license. Alternatively, government agencies like the New York State Department of Transportation and federal entities such as the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ers provide stable career tracks with benefits like pensions. Small firms also play a role in the local employment landscape, presenting opportunities for quicker project responsibility but often lacking the structured training associated with larger organizations. Graduates should prioritize passing the FE exam to secure an Engineering Intern (EIT) designation as a fundamental step toward further advancement, as achieving a PE license opens doors to senior roles and project management opportunities within the industry.
